Transaction 49efb2175aeee43b7953e751066b81907437083de859fabc895a026d1537a0c5
1 Input
2 Outputs
- 49efb2175aeee43b7953e751066b81907437083de859fabc895a026d1537a0c5:0
- 49efb2175aeee43b7953e751066b81907437083de859fabc895a026d1537a0c5:1
value 42000000
address 19ZsLfk4ksxyefV7oXTyAfe4G3iBzDs6nZ
value 39328725
address 15VdDbFfjdAtCULDrabdF3Qn1Rf97kjpsS